How Our Foundation Leak Water Removal Process Works
When you call us for foundation leak water removal, you can expect our experienced technicians to follow a meticulous process that ensures every drop of water is extracted and your home is thoroughly dried. We use only the most advanced equipment and techniques to reduce disruption and get the job done right the first time.
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
We’ll send a trained technician to your property to assess the damage and identify the source of the leak. They’ll use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and pinpoint the affected areas.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using powerful pumps and vacuums, our team will extract as much water as possible from the affected area, including standing water, saturated carpets, and damaged drywall.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use commercial-grade dehumidifiers and fans to dry out the area, reduce moisture levels, and prevent further damage.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
To prevent mold, mildew, and other waterborne hazards, we’ll apply a sanitizing solution to the affected areas and ensure they’re thoroughly dried and disinfected.
Step 5: Repair and Restoration
Once the area is dry and sanitized, our team will repair and restore your home to its original condition, including fixing damaged drywall, replacing carpets, and repairing or replacing affected structural elements.

Warning Signs You Need Foundation Leak Water Removal
Ignoring the warning signs of a foundation leak can lead to costly damage, structural problems, and even safety hazards. Keep an eye out for these common indicators: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ors in your basement or crawlspace can signal the presence of mold, mildew, or other waterborne hazards.
Water Stains or Warping on Floors and Walls
Visible signs of water damage, such as stains, warping, or buckling, can show a more serious issue with your foundation.
Sound of Running Water or Dripping
Unusual sounds, such as running water or dripping, can show a leak in your foundation or pipes.
Water Seeping Through Cracks in the Foundation
Water seeping through cracks in your foundation can cause significant damage and compromise the structural integrity of your home.
Unusual Settlement or Sinking of Your Home
Unusual settlement or sinking of your home can show a more serious issue with your foundation, such as a leak or shifting soil.
High Humidity Levels in Your Home
High humidity levels in your home can create an environment conducive to mold growth and other waterborne hazards.

Foundation Leak Water Removal Cost in Methuen, MA
The cost of foundation leak water removal services in Methuen, MA, can vary widely dep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common sub-services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, water depth, and equipment needed.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, moisture levels, and equipment needed. |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, hazard level, and materials needed. |
| Repair and Rest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| Scope of repairs, materials needed, and labor involved. |
| Foundation Inspection and Assessment | $100 – $500 | Size of property, complexity of issue, and equipment needed. |
| Emergency Response and Water Removal | $500 – $2,000 | Time of day, severity of issue, and equipment needed. |
Keep in mind that these estimates are based on average costs and may vary depending on your specific situation. We offer free on-site assessments to provide a more accurate estimate for your foundation leak water removal needs.
